    Default shocked turned my pool green.. help!!

    Hi all, I am a new pool owner.. I filled up my pool via well water.. It looked absolutely BEAUTIFUL, until I put in the shock, that is!! Within minutes it turned green. What's up with that?? From what I've been reading it looks as if I have either iron or copper?? If so, what do I do to get rid of that?? All my numbers are reading ok, I need help!!! lol.. Specific product name and where to get it would be especially helpful

    Default Re: shocked turned my pool green.. help!!

    You will have to get a sequestering agent like "metal free" or "sequasol", or "Jack's Magic". You can get them on the web, or at a pool store - it is sometimes called a stain and scale preventor. Keep your ph at 7.2 for now, and don't shock again for 2 weeks after putting in the sequestering agent. Keep your filter running 24/7. Let us know what happens. You have to post all of your numbers, chlorine, combined chlorine, ph, alkalinity, calcium and cya. All of these numbers work to let us know what you should put in your pool.
